如何使DNS服务器响应
-
要使DNS服务器能够响应请求,可以采取以下几个措施:
-
配置正确的DNS解析器:首先,确保在服务器的网络设置中正确配置了DNS解析器。这可以通过编辑网络设置文件(如resolv.conf)或使用网络管理工具来完成。确保将可靠的、可用的DNS解析器的IP地址添加到配置中,以便服务器能够向它发送DNS查询请求。
-
启用DNS服务:在服务器上安装并启用DNS服务器软件,如Bind、DNSmasq等。这些软件提供了将域名解析为IP地址的功能,并能够响应来自客户端的DNS查询请求。
-
配置DNS区域:在DNS服务器上配置并管理域名的DNS区域。DNS区域记录了域名和对应的IP地址、邮箱服务器等信息。根据需要创建新的区域,添加相应的域名和IP地址记录。确保每个域名都有正确的解析记录。
-
优化网络设置:确保服务器的网络连接稳定,并且具有足够的带宽来处理DNS查询请求。如果服务器的网络连接不稳定或带宽不足,可能会导致DNS服务器响应缓慢或无法响应。
-
配置防火墙规则:如果服务器上启用了防火墙,确保配置了适当的规则,允许DNS查询请求通过。防火墙可能会阻止来自客户端的DNS查询请求,导致服务器无法响应。
-
监测和维护:定期监测DNS服务器的运行状态和性能,确保它能够正常响应请求。如果发现问题,及时采取措施来修复或优化服务器环境。
通过以上措施,可以确保DNS服务器能够正常响应查询请求,并提供准确的域名解析服务。这对于网络的正常运行和用户的访问体验至关重要。
1年前 -
-
要使DNS服务器能够响应请求,以下是一些关键的步骤:
-
安装和设置DNS服务器:首先,需要安装和设置一个可靠的DNS服务器软件。常见的DNS服务器软件包括BIND、PowerDNS、dnsmasq等。根据操作系统和需求,选择合适的软件,并按照其官方文档进行安装和配置。
-
配置DNS服务器:配置DNS服务器包括设置服务器的IP地址、监听端口以及域名的转发和解析规则。可以使用配置文件或Web界面来进行配置。确保在配置文件中指定正确的域名信息,并将服务器设置为可用状态。
-
添加区域和资源记录:DNS服务器需要知道如何解析特定域名。为此,需要添加区域和相关的资源记录。每个区域代表一个域名,其中包含了该域名下所有主机的信息。资源记录定义了域名与其对应的IP地址之间的映射关系。根据具体的需求,可以添加A记录、CNAME记录、MX记录等。
-
确保网络连接稳定:DNS服务器需要与互联网保持稳定的连接。确保服务器的网络接口正常工作,且能够进行正常的网络通信。检查服务器的网络配置,例如网关、DNS服务器地址等设置,确保其正确。
-
监控和维护服务器:监测DNS服务器的性能和运行状态,及时发现问题并采取相应的措施。使用监控工具或脚本来检查服务器的运行情况,例如CPU和内存使用情况、网络延迟等。进行定期的备份,以便在出现故障时能够快速恢复。
总结起来,要使DNS服务器能够响应请求,需要安装和设置一个可靠的DNS服务器软件,配置服务器的IP地址和监听端口,添加区域和资源记录,确保网络连接稳定,以及监控和维护服务器的运行状态。
1年前 -
-
为了使DNS服务器有效地响应DNS查询请求,有以下几个方面需要考虑和处理:
-
配置服务器:首先,需要配置DNS服务器以使其能够接受查询请求。这通常涉及到指定服务器的IP地址、端口号等信息。您可以使用DNS服务器软件,如BIND(Berkeley Internet Name Domain)或dnsmasq等来实现。
-
设置名称解析区域:DNS服务器通常分为不同的区域,每个区域包含一组关联域名的记录。您需要设置和配置这些区域,以便服务器能够解析并响应相应的域名查询请求。这通常通过配置服务器上的区域文件(如BIND中的zone文件)来完成。
-
添加DNS记录:每个区域文件中包含了一系列的DNS记录,其中包括主机名(如http://www.example.com)、IP地址(如192.168.1.1)以及其他相关的记录类型(如MX记录、CNAME记录等)。您需要根据需要添加相应的记录以满足查询请求。
-
缓存设置:DNS服务器可以缓存已经解析过的域名和IP地址映射关系,以提高查询效率。您可以设置服务器的缓存策略,例如设置缓存时间、缓存大小等。这可以通过修改服务器的配置文件来完成。
-
安全性设置:DNS服务器也需要考虑安全性。您可以配置服务器以阻止未经授权的查询请求或者开启DNSSEC(Domain Name System Security Extensions)来对DNS响应进行加密和验证。
-
监控和优化:为了确保DNS服务器的稳定运行和高效响应,您需要监控和优化服务器的性能。可以使用监控工具来跟踪服务器的请求量、响应时间等指标,并根据需要进行性能优化,如增加服务器的带宽、增加服务器的数量等。
此外,还有其他一些高级的技术和功能可以用于优化DNS服务器的响应,如负载均衡、任播技术等,根据具体的需求和规模,可以选择相应的技术来提高DNS服务器的响应性能。
1年前 -